Event: Lady Gaga joins in with The MAC VIVA GLAM launch to benefit the MAC AIDS Fund

By Andrea Petrou on March 2nd, 2010 0 comments yet. Be the First

It was a case of who could look the most disheveled at last night’s MAC Viva Glam product launch to benefit the MAC AIDS Fund in London.

Lady Gaga, who fronted the campaign alongside Cyndi Lauper, as always stole the style show, appearing in a black lace leotard with sharp shoulders. She finished the look with lace stockings, which she wore over the bodysuit as well as a mamouth PVC style hat in the shape of a flower and her trademark eye mask.

However, after her appearance it seems the style took a turn for the worse. Cyndi Lauper turned up with a perm more fit for the 80s, making her look more like a poodle than a celebrity, while usually flawless Agyness Deyn looked more John Lenon than model with her blue sunglasses.

Sharon Osbourne however, hasn’t really given us any cause for comment as she seemingly left her coat on all night.
